๐ Enhanced Key Takeaways
- โขSamsung is reportedly integrating a new 'Galaxy Neural Engine' into the upcoming foldables to handle on-device generative AI tasks without cloud latency.
- โขThe smart glasses are rumored to be developed in partnership with Google and Qualcomm, utilizing a custom version of Android optimized for XR (Extended Reality).
- โขNew wearable devices are expected to feature advanced non-invasive blood glucose monitoring sensors, a significant upgrade over previous health-tracking iterations.
- โขThe foldable lineup will likely introduce a 'tri-fold' or 'rollable' prototype alongside the standard Z Fold and Z Flip iterations to test market viability.
- โขSamsung is shifting its software strategy to prioritize 'Agentic AI,' where the device proactively manages user schedules and app interactions across the ecosystem.

โณ Timeline
2019-02
Samsung launches the original Galaxy Fold, pioneering the commercial foldable smartphone market.
2021-08
Introduction of S Pen support for the Galaxy Z Fold series, expanding productivity capabilities.
2023-07
Release of the Galaxy Z Flip5 featuring a significantly larger cover screen.
2024-01
Samsung officially launches Galaxy AI with the S24 series, marking the start of its AI-first hardware strategy.
2025-07
Samsung expands Galaxy AI features to the Z Fold6 and Z Flip6, focusing on real-time translation and generative editing.
